Broken Seals
The majority of modern windows have double panes. They are filled with gas or air (typically argon, krypton, or Krypton) and then made to be sealed by the factory. The gas helps keep heat inside in the winter and out in the summer which makes them an excellent energy-efficient choice. As time passes, seals will break down. After the seal has broken, moisture begins to leak into the spaces between the glass panes. This will lead to a foggy appearance and lowered insulation efficiency, meaning your home isn't as comfortable or warm as it could be.
The most common cause of the broken window seal is the natural expansion and contraction of components used to construct the frame. Since the window is exposed to a variety of temperatures and humidity levels, it can expand and contract slightly in response. The cycle of expansion and contraction could eventually cause the seal to fail.
Other factors can also cause the seals in your windows to fail. Seals are more likely to break on older windows that have been exposed to the elements for a long time. The natural settling of your house can shift the frame around your windows, which can put extra pressure on the seals.
A damaged window seal could lead to a host of other problems if unfixed. For instance, if the seals fail, water can enter your home, leading to mold and mildew growth as well as lower the quality of your indoor air. It could also cause water damage to your home as well as the loss of energy efficiency. It is essential to contact a professional immediately if you spot signs of a broken seal, such as fogging or drafts. You could end up with high heating and air conditioning bills, a uncomfortable home, and expensive repairs if you do not.

Double-glazed windows can become smoky if the rubber seal that blocks moisture starts to break down. This is most prevalent in areas of the UK where winters are wet with high humidity. After the seal has broken, moisture can enter the void between glass panes and cause them to mist.
There are many ways to fix a window that has become misty. One method to fix a window that is misty is to thoroughly clean it. Another option is to use a defogging agent. This involves drilling a small hole within the window, and spraying a special dry agent into the empty space. It is essential to be aware that this method might not work in all instances and can be very expensive.
The third option to fix a smoky, double-glazed window near me is to replace the glass pane by itself. If the frame of the window and other components of the window are in good working order, this is a cost-effective solution. This procedure is less demanding and expensive than replacing the entire window. It can also be done quickly. It is essential to inquire with a glazier whether the quoted price includes any hidden costs.
